Output 118b492d95d5b5ea1dfd51d75b11076d324c3c65c84a9a6314c4abdc3f9314df:1

value
21476322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4edd8ddbedef1680a2a7ee531f5e13ab52e28a8a OP_EQUALVERIFY OP_CHECKSIG
address
18C17pDbyQ6YRAXBZNn9c9BSDM8z1nHc7v
transaction
118b492d95d5b5ea1dfd51d75b11076d324c3c65c84a9a6314c4abdc3f9314df
confirmations
499983
spent
true